?

JWT(??JSON Web Token)和Token通常(/ω\)在Web應用中用于身份驗證和授??權,雖然它們都用于安全地傳輸信息,但它們的工作方式、結構和用途有(you)所不同,以下詳細比較了JWT和Tokenヾ(?■_■)ノ的主要區別:
1. 定義
JWT: JSON Web Token是一種開(kāi)放標準(RFC 7519),它定義了一種緊湊且自包含的方式,用于在各方之間安全地傳輸信息作為JSON對象,??這些信息可以被驗證和信任,因為它們是數字簽名的。
Token: 在廣泛的意義上,Token可ヽ(′ー`)ノ以指任何用作驗證、信息交換等的字符串或數據結構,它可以是訪(fǎng)問(wèn)令牌、會(huì )話(huà)令牌等,具體取決于其使用場(chǎng)景。
. 結構
JWT: 由三部分組成:Header(頭部)、Payloa??d(負載)、Signature(簽名),頭部通常由兩部分組成:令牌的類(lèi)型(“JWT”)和所使用的簽名算法,負載包含聲明(claims),這些聲??明可以包括標識符、用戶(hù)??名等信息,簽名用于驗證令牌的發(fā)送者是否就是他們自稱(chēng)的那個(gè)人,并且負載沒(méi)有在傳輸過(guò)程中被更改??。
Token: 結構可能因實(shí)現而異,可以是簡(jiǎn)單的字符串、復雜的數據結構等。
. 安全性
Toke??n: 安全性取決于實(shí)現,OAuth 2.0訪(fǎng)問(wèn)令牌的安全性取決于它們是如何使用和保護的。
4. 可撤銷(xiāo)性
JWT: JWT本身不是可撤銷(xiāo)的,一旦令牌被發(fā)出并給了用戶(hù),除非服務(wù)器愿??意接受它,否則沒(méi)有辦法使其(′;д;`)無(wú)效。
Token: 某些類(lèi)型的Token(如OAuth 2.0訪(fǎng)問(wèn)令牌)可以被撤銷(xiāo)。
5. 使用場(chǎng)景
JWT: 常用于需要(′_`)輕量級、自包含的身份驗證信息的場(chǎng)合,如API安全、單點(diǎn)登錄等。
Token: 根據類(lèi)??型和實(shí)現,可用于各種場(chǎng)景,包括身份驗證、授權、API調用等。
6. 大小和性能
Tok??en: 大小和性能取決于實(shí)現,簡(jiǎn)單的訪(fǎng)問(wèn)令牌可能比JWT小得多,從而提供更好的性能。
7. 兼容性和靈活性
JWT: JWT是一種開(kāi)放標準,具有廣泛的庫和工具支持,由于其自包含的性質(zhì),它??可能不如其他類(lèi)型的To(?⊿?)ken靈活。
Token: 靈活性取決于(′ω`)實(shí)現,自定義Token可以實(shí)現特定的(╬?益?)功能和優(yōu)化(hua),但可能需要更多的工作來(lái)確??保兼容??性。
歸納
友情鏈接:
咸寧通尚網(wǎng)絡(luò )科技有限公司東港寶藍網(wǎng)絡(luò )科技有限公司常寧碼揚網(wǎng)絡(luò )科技有限公司白城輝富網(wǎng)絡(luò )科技有限公司從化發(fā)星網(wǎng)絡(luò )科技有限公司新疆米泉航彩網(wǎng)絡(luò )科技有限公司津越開(kāi)網(wǎng)絡(luò )科技有限公司膠南詩(shī)揚網(wǎng)絡(luò )科技有限公司淮南集集網(wǎng)絡(luò )科技有限公司海林長(cháng)名網(wǎng)絡(luò )科技有限公司延吉春立網(wǎng)絡(luò )科技有限公司什邡霸界網(wǎng)絡(luò )科技有限公司華陰爾辰網(wǎng)絡(luò )科技有限公司
© 2013-2025.Company name All rights reserved.網(wǎng)站地圖 天津九安特機電工程有限公司-More Templates